Timeline: Your 2-Week Offsite Planning Checklist

Week 1

  • Day 1-2: Define goals and budget. What do you want to achieve? Allocate approximately $250 per person for the entire offsite.
  • Day 3-4: Research venues and send out inquiries. Look for availability and pricing.
  • Day 5: Choose a venue and book it. Confirm the capacity (30 people) and negotiate terms.
  • Day 6: Plan logistics for transportation and accommodations.
  • Day 7: Finalize the agenda and activities that align with your goals.

Week 2

  • Day 8-9: Confirm catering and AV needs with the venue.
  • Day 10: Send out invites and share the agenda with participants.
  • Day 11: Coordinate with vendors for any offsite activities.
  • Day 12-13: Final checks on logistics and confirmations.
  • Day 14: Execute the plan and enjoy the offsite!

Budget Breakdown for Your Offsite

Here's a sample budget breakdown for a 30-person offsite:

| Category | Estimated Cost | Percentage of Total | |-----------------|----------------|---------------------| | Venue | $6,000 | 40% | | Food & Beverage | $3,750 | 25% | | Activities | $2,250 | 15% | | Travel | $2,250 | 15% | | Contingency | $750 | 5% | | Total | $15,000 | 100% |

Risk Mitigation: What Could Go Wrong and How to Prevent It

  • Venue Overbooking: Confirm your reservation with a follow-up call a week before.
  • Catering Issues: Have a backup plan for meals, like a list of nearby restaurants.
  • Travel Delays: Encourage early arrivals and provide a group chat for updates.
